Output 16bd59a068b33fa4356d6f8f56ce62ba9bf3a712d3411c6033f1ca941a79c2dc:0

value
683696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eef78a688b02a78c2c64fdd0d3a4568fc1e6671 OP_EQUAL
address
3HdzNgMFTn1G8bF7StPrRoLn2Z52xWb6fX
transaction
16bd59a068b33fa4356d6f8f56ce62ba9bf3a712d3411c6033f1ca941a79c2dc
spent
true